Small and wide-angle X-ray scattering (SWAXS) is a useful technique for probing the size, shape, reactivity, and interactions of dissolved species. It has been used extensively to characterize dissolved biomolecules, polymers, quantum dots, and nanoparticles. Chemical pulps are produced by chemical delignification of lignocelluloses such as wood or annual non-woody plants. After pulping (e.g., kraft pulping), the remaining lignin is removed by bleaching to produce a high quality, bright paper.
